Default Re: what tires for 7.5" rim? (willydawsonv)

Your stock size is 195/55/15. Overall diameter is 23.44 inches. If you go with a 205/40/17, your overall diameter is 23.45 inches. If you go with a 215/40/17, your overall diamter is 23.77 inches. It doesn't affect your ride or speedometer too much. You're only off by .16 inches on either side. Rolling the rear fenders would be a good idea.
